Predicting a low, gulf-wide red tide for the Gulf of Maine

map showing concentrations of Alexandrium cysts in Gulf of Maine bottom sediments in October 2023.NOAA is predicting a low, gulf-wide red tide for the Gulf of Maine this summer, continuing the pattern of smaller blooms observed in the region over the last few years. Scientists can estimate the size of red tides in the spring and summer by counting the number of Alexandrium cysts in bottom sediments the preceding fall.  https://coastalscience.noaa.gov/news/low-gulf-of-maine-red-tide-predicted-for-2024
